Kentucky’s James Young hits miracle behind-the-back shot -- into the wrong hoop

Is this two points or three? Genuinely unsure of the rules.

Mark Zerof-USA TODAY Sports

When the No. 1 team in the country plays an Division II school, you can expect it to be a blowout. So how come Kentucky is up less than 20 points on some school called Montevallo?

Well, they’re not helping their own cause:

That’s James Young, one of the top freshmen in the nation. Does a once-in-a-lifetime shot into the other team’s basket count as a freshman mistake?
